In every service I conduct, I make an effort to include original spiritual input of some sort from the congregation. Sometimes this includes
children -- and sometimes it means asking children to do typically adult tasks. As one example, I have asked children to lead our Sunday prayers. That does not merely mean
reading prayers, but
composing prayers.
OBSERVATION: The results have been surprising. I do not remember having been disappointed by a child -- rather, impressed. They do receive guidelines, though not always coaching. Occasionally parents have told me that they didn't want coaching even from their parents -- they wanted this to be
their prayers.
